About us
Just when it seemed like rock had died a bland post-punk-emo-indie death, the dynamic quintet Pauper Kings enter with a refreshingly energetic and upbeat contribution to British music. The band was formed when vocalist Dave Blomiley and drummer Ollie Brown realised there was a gap in the rock scene that urgently needed to be filled with Blomiley’s charismatically unique voice and Brown’s incredible flair for detail. As their music evolved into the rambunctious rock that characterises the band, in 2006 guitarist Chris Buckley was ushered in with electrifying solos and inventive riffs, shortly followed by jazz-rooted Sam Norman’s funky but solid bass lines. The final addition to the group, Woody, completed the line-up with his metal-influenced guitar style, bringing a new dimension to the band’s increasingly popular sound. Punchy, melodic and ever-distinctive, Pauper Kings are currently playing the London circuit and recording their first album.
